图书介绍
Web应用项目开发PDF|Epub|txt|kindle电子书版本下载
![Web应用项目开发](https://www.shukui.net/cover/57/33898745.jpg)
- 孙勇,林菲主编 著
- 出版社: 北京:电子工业出版社
- ISBN:9787121169793
- 出版时间:2012
- 标注页数:164页
- 文件大小:16MB
- 文件页数:174页
- 主题词:网页制作工具-高等学校-教材
PDF下载
下载说明
Web应用项目开发P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 Web应用项目的立项1
1.1什么是Web应用1
1.1.1互联网软件架构模式1
1.1.2 Web应用的发展和主流开发平台2
1.2 Web应用项目开发方法概述3
1.2.1瀑布模型4
1.2.2迭代模型4
1.2.3其他开发方法5
1.2.4开发过程模型选择6
1.3学期项目:毕业工作管理系统简介6
1.3.1课程面向的职业岗位6
1.3.2针对职业岗位形成的学期项目7
1.4任务一:签订立项合同8
1.4.1任务书模板8
1.4.2工作流程及要点解析9
1.5任务二:组建项目团队11
1.5.1任务书模板11
1.5.2工作流程及要点解析12
1.6任务三:制订开发计划13
1.6.1任务书模板14
1.6.2工作流程及要点解析14
1.7拓展训练与思考15
第2章 Web应用项目的需求分析16
2.1什么是软件需求16
2.2任务一:学期项目需求调研17
2.2.1任务书模板17
2.2.2工作流程及要点解析17
2.3 UML概述18
2.3.1 UML和模型图18
2.3.2用例图19
2.3.3活动图20
2.4任务二:学期项目用例建模21
2.4.1任务书模板21
2.4.2工作流程及要点解析21
2.5任务三:学期项目行为建模22
2.5.1任务书模板23
2.5.2工作流程及要点解析23
2.6任务四:非功能性需求的分析24
2.6.1任务书模板24
2.6.2工作流程及要点解析24
2.7任务五:需求说明书撰写25
2.7.1需求说明书概述25
2.7.2任务书模板27
2.7.3工作流程及要点解析27
2.8拓展训练与思考28
第3章 Web应用项目的系统设计29
3.1什么是系统设计29
3.2分层架构30
3.2.1软件为什么要分层30
3.2.2分层的原则31
3.2.3三层架构32
3.3设计目标33
3.4 Web应用系统设计的过程34
3.4.1概念架构设计35
3.4.2技术架构设计36
3.4.3功能设计37
3.5数据库设计37
3.5.1数据库设计的步骤38
3.5.2创建E-R模型39
3.5.3将E-R模型映射为表40
3.5.4物理数据库实现42
3.6任务一:学期项目数据库设计46
3.6.1任务书模板47
3.6.2工作流程及要点解析47
3.7任务二:学期项目系统设计50
3.7.1任务书模板50
3.7.2工作流程及要点解析50
3.8任务三:撰写系统设计说明书52
3.9拓展训练与思考53
第4章 Web应用项目的交互设计55
4.1界面设计原则和指导准则55
4.1.1设计有限用户界面的原则56
4.1.2指导准则58
4.2界面设计工作流58
4.3美学设计59
4.3.1如何创建令人愉悦的布局59
4.3.2什么是好的图形设计60
4.4可用性设计60
4.5任务一:学期项目界面布局设计62
4.5.1任务书模板62
4.5.2工作流程及要点解析62
4.6任务二:学期项目导航设计64
4.6.1任务书模板64
4.6.2工作流程及要点解析64
4.7任务三:学期项目“国际化”设计66
4.7.1任务书模板66
4.7.2工作流程及要点解析66
4.8任务四:学期项目登录界面设计67
4.8.1任务书模板67
4.8.2工作流程及要点解析67
4.9拓展训练与思考70
第5章 Web应用项目的编码71
5.1编码指导原则71
5.1.1绝不重复71
5.1.2通俗易懂73
5.1.3严堵漏洞75
5.1.4版本控制76
5.2任务一:使用三层架构完成代码框架设计77
5.2.1任务书模板77
5.2.2工作流程及要点解析77
5.3任务二:用户角色和访问控制模块编码设计88
5.3.1任务书模板88
5.3.2工作流程及要点解析89
5.4任务三:基本工具模块编码设计91
5.4.1任务书模板91
5.4.2工作流程及要点解析91
5.5任务四:毕业资料管理模块编码设计94
5.5.1任务书模板94
5.5.2工作流程及要点解析94
5.6任务五:系统性能调优96
5.6.1任务书模板97
5.6.2工作流程及要点解析98
5.7拓展训练与思考99
第6章 Web应用项目的测试102
6.1测试的心理依据和原则102
6.1.1心理依据103
6.1.2测试原则104
6.2任务一:学期项目单元测试104
6.2.1单元测试框架105
6.2.2任务书模板107
6.3任务二:学期项目性能测试107
6.3.1性能测试基础107
6.3.2性能测试的重要性108
6.3.3自动化性能测试工具109
6.3.4任务书模板110
6.3.5工作流程及要点解析110
6.4任务三:学期项目安全性测试113
6.4.1常见安全性威胁和术语114
6.4.2 OWASP十大项目115
6.4.3测试十大项目的方法116
6.4.4任务书模板119
6.5拓展训练与思考120
第7章 Web应用项目的部署121
7.1部署的内容121
7.2部署准备工作121
7.3任务一:使用复制网站工具部署学期项目122
7.3.1任务书模板122
7.3.2工作流程及要点解析123
7.4任务二:使用发布网站工具部署学期项目127
7.4.1任务书模板127
7.4.2工作流程及要点解析127
7.5任务三:创建安装包部署学期项目129
7.5.1任务书模板129
7.5.2工作流程及要点解析129
7.6任务四:学期项目总结135
7.6.1任务书模板136
7.6.2工作流程及要点解析136
7.7拓展训练与思考139
附录A 用户需求说明书模板141
附录B 系统设计说明书模板148
附录C 数据库设计说明书模板154
附录D IIS安装及虚拟目录创建161
参考文献164